On this week-long intercultural trip, you’ll scale the ancient pyramids of Teotihuacán and follow in the footsteps of Frida Kahlo and Diego Rivera in Coyoacán. Setting this trip apart, we will travel around la Ciudad de México with locals, offering guests a one-of-a-kind perspective on contemporary life in this big city.
Additional highlights of this visit to the Mexican capital include:
An immersion into the 1500s world of the first missions of New Spain, with their incredible frescos and monumental size.
An exploration of the architecture and murals of the Zócalo and Centro Histórico of Mexico City.
We’ll experience Mexico’s National History Museum at the Castillo de Chapultepec.
A movable feast of UNESCO World Heritage-recognized cuisine.

Activity Level:
Moderate plus. The good thing about being built on a former lake is that everywhere you go is relatively flat. That said, there will be walking almost every day, given our central location adjacent to the historic city center and Reforma Avenue.
